6.7 hectometers = 670 meters.
Solution:
Given 6.7 hectometers.
To convert hectometers into meters:
Conversion unit:
1 hectometer = 100 meters
We have 6.7 hectometers.
So multiply 6.7 by 100, we get
6.7 hectometers = 6.7 × 100 meters
= 670 meters
Hence 6.7 hectometers = 670 meters.

Answer:
The surface area is approx. 1017.9 in^2.
Step-by-step explanation:
Total surface area of cone = πrl + πr^2. Since the radius is 12 in. and the slant height is 15 in, substitute 12 for r and 15 for l.
A = π(12)(15) + π(12)^2
= 180π + 144π
= 324π in^2
≈ 1017.9 in^2
